JS的document.all函數(shù)怎么使用

js
小億
111
2024-03-18 20:47:33

document.all函數(shù)在JavaScript中已經(jīng)被廢棄,不再建議使用。在現(xiàn)代的Web開發(fā)中,可以使用document.getElementById()函數(shù)來(lái)獲取頁(yè)面中的元素節(jié)點(diǎn)。示例如下:

// 獲取id為myElement的元素節(jié)點(diǎn)
var element = document.getElementById("myElement");

// 修改元素的文本內(nèi)容
element.innerHTML = "Hello, World!";

如果需要獲取頁(yè)面中的多個(gè)元素節(jié)點(diǎn),可以使用document.querySelectorAll()函數(shù)。示例如下:

// 獲取所有class為myClass的元素節(jié)點(diǎn)
var elements = document.querySelectorAll(".myClass");

// 修改所有元素的文本內(nèi)容
elements.forEach(function(element) {
  element.innerHTML = "Hello, World!";
});

請(qǐng)注意,在使用以上方法時(shí),需要確保頁(yè)面中存在相應(yīng)的元素節(jié)點(diǎn),否則會(huì)出現(xiàn)錯(cuò)誤。

0